vs.net打包程序時(shí)設(shè)置自動(dòng)檢測(cè)環(huán)境并安裝.net framwork
收藏vs.net打包程序或者制作安裝程序時(shí)自動(dòng)檢測(cè)環(huán)境并安裝.net framwork的設(shè)置方法之前我看過文檔也做過,但是過一段時(shí)間又忘了,現(xiàn)在終于又找到方法了,還是把這個(gè)方法寫下來吧,方便自己也方便大家將來查詢用。
vs.net打包或者制作安裝程序時(shí)進(jìn)行自動(dòng)檢測(cè)環(huán)境并安裝.net framwork的設(shè)置方法:
1. 新建一個(gè)“安裝和部署”的項(xiàng)目;
2. 然后點(diǎn)擊“視圖”菜單,選擇“編輯器”--“文件系統(tǒng)”,然后將要打包的程序以及相關(guān)文件添加進(jìn)來,之后程序?qū)⒆詣?dòng)檢測(cè)依賴項(xiàng);
3. 再次選擇“視圖”菜單,選擇“編輯器”--“啟動(dòng)條件”,打開這個(gè)界面后會(huì)自動(dòng)啟動(dòng)條件里一般都會(huì)自動(dòng)添加“.NET Framework”項(xiàng);
4. 右鍵點(diǎn)擊應(yīng)用程序名選擇“屬性”,在彈出的屬性頁對(duì)話框中,點(diǎn)擊“系統(tǒng)必備”按鈕;
5. 在“請(qǐng)選擇要安裝的系統(tǒng)必備組件”里把“.NET Framework 2.0”復(fù)選框勾上;
6. 在“指定系統(tǒng)必備的安裝位置”里選中“從與我應(yīng)用程序相同的位置下載系統(tǒng)必備組件”,這樣就可以保證你下載的.net framwork版本跟自己所做的程序需要的.net framwork版本相同;
7. 確定后再次編譯,在debug文件夾下會(huì)自動(dòng)下載并生成“dotnetfx”文件夾,里面有應(yīng)用程序需要的.net framwork安裝程序;
8. 選中第3步的啟動(dòng)條件選項(xiàng)卡,展開“啟動(dòng)條件”文件夾,點(diǎn)擊“.NET Framework”,切換到屬性管理器中,將其屬性“InstallUrl”的值設(shè)置為“dotnetfx\dotnetfx.exe”路徑即可;
9. 再次編譯安裝程序就完整的制作出來啦。
本站僅提供存儲(chǔ)服務(wù),所有內(nèi)容均由用戶發(fā)布,如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請(qǐng)
點(diǎn)擊舉報(bào)。